Overview

Yahong Zhang is a researcher affiliated with Fudan University in China. Their work primarily spans the fields of Engineering and Materials Science, with a focus on subfields such as Materials Chemistry, Inorganic Chemistry, Civil and Structural Engineering, Electronic, Optical and Magnetic Materials, and Biomedical Engineering.

The main topics of Zhang's research include:

  • Zeolite Catalysis and Synthesis
  • Electromagnetic wave absorption materials
  • Advanced Antenna and Metasurface Technologies
  • Catalysis and Hydrodesulfurization Studies
  • Vibration Control and Rheological Fluids
  • Electrocatalysts for Energy Conversion
  • Metamaterials and Metasurfaces Applications

Zhang has contributed to various scientific journals and conferences, with frequent publications appearing in venues such as:

  • SSRN Electronic Journal
  • Angewandte Chemie
  • Journal of Colloid and Interface Science
  • ACS Applied Materials & Interfaces
  • Angewandte Chemie International Edition

Significant recent papers include:

  • "TiN/Ni/C ternary composites with expanded heterogeneous interfaces for efficient microwave absorption" (2020) in Composites Part B Engineering
  • "Facile synthesis of BN/Ni nanocomposites for effective regulation of microwave absorption performance" (2020) in Journal of Alloys and Compounds
  • "Biomass-derived heterogeneous RGO/Ni/C composite with hollow structure for high-efficiency electromagnetic wave absorption" (2023) in Materials Today Physics

Frequent collaborators in Zhang's research activities include Yi Tang, Yajun Luo, Shilin Xie, Ke Du, and Boxu Gao, reflecting sustained scientific cooperation in various projects.
